Inner East Area Committee
12th June 2003
Play and Youth Summer Activities
Report by: Head of Community & Housing
Ward Implications: Sandyford, Jesmond, Heaton, Dene.
For decision
1. Synopsis
1.1 This report outlines the proposed summer play and youth activity programme
for young people aged between 5 – 19 years old, residing in the Inner East
Area.
2. Background
2.1 Traditionally the Play and Youth Service has received funding from local ward
sub committees. It has been noted that such monies were set up for ward
issues and that monies given for playschemes were a huge drain on this
resource. The summer programme is an integral part of yearly provision in the
Inner East area and as such, monies need to be sought to sustain this
essential service that we provide in the July and August months.
3. The Provision
Due to the success of last years outdoor educational summer programme for
3.1
the 13 – 19 age range in the Inner East, a similar theme has been explored for
this summer.
The programme for 5 – 13 year olds has been revised for the coming summer,
emphasizing publicity is of paramount importance and a reduction of sites to
create continuity.
Publicity will be in the form of an Inner East leaflet. This will be distributed 2
weeks prior to the end of the school term. Publicity will also be on display in
libraries, local shops etc
